Recognizing the Recovery Timeline



During the first few days after cataract surgical procedure, you'll start to discover renovations in your vision. Initially, your eyes might really feel a bit scratchy or sensitive to light, yet these feelings ought to gradually decrease as your eyes recover. It's common to experience some blurriness or haziness instantly after the surgical treatment, however this need to improve over the very first week. Your specialist will likely arrange a follow-up appointment within the very first couple of days to check your progression and guarantee that everything is healing as expected.

As the days pass, you might notice that colors show up more dynamic, and your vision comes to be clearer. Gradual Resumption of Daily Activities



Ease back right into your day-to-day regular slowly after cataract surgical treatment to prevent any type of stress on your eyes and sustain a smooth recovery procedure. Beginning by preventing hefty lifting, difficult activities, and flexing over for the very first couple of days following surgical procedure. As your eyes recover, slowly reintroduce light activities like analysis, enjoying television, and utilizing the computer system. Keep in mind to use any type of safety glasses recommended by your medical professional throughout this time.

After concerning a week, you can generally resume light household duties and gentle exercises like walking. Beware with activities that include flexing at the waistline or training hefty things. If you experience any kind of pain or vision changes during these tasks, pause and rest your eyes.

Around 2 weeks post-surgery, many people can start driving once again if authorized by their eye treatment carrier.
